GUIDE PRICE £525,000 - £550,000

We are pleased to present this impressive four-bedroom detached property is located on Hill Top in Cwmbran, formerly the Old Vicarage. The property occupies a generous corner plot and enjoys stunning panoramic views across the surrounding countryside. The property offers a peaceful and elevated setting while remaining conveniently close to local amenities, including shops, supermarkets and well-regarded schools. Cwmbran town centre is just a short distance away, providing a wide range of retail, dining and leisure facilities, including the shopping centre and leisure complex. For commuters, there is excellent access to the A4042, linking to Newport, Pontypool and the M4 motorway, while Cwmbran railway station offers regular services. The nearby parks, woodland walks and green open spaces further enhance the lifestyle appeal of this location.

You enter the property through a spacious and welcoming hallway, which provides access to the ground floor rooms and the staircase to the first floor. Along the left are two generous living areas, both featuring charming log burner fireplaces and offering ample space for a range of seating and dining arrangements. These rooms create a warm and versatile living environment and both lead out to a large conservatory that spans the width of the property, and benefits from underfloor heating. This bright and expansive space provides additional room for seating and entertaining, while making the most of the stunning surrounding views. Across the hall is the modern fitted kitchen, offering a good range of storage and worktop space. The ground floor also benefits from a large preparation kitchen/utility area and a convenient cloakroom.

On the first floor are four large double bedrooms and the family bathroom. All bedrooms are well proportioned, providing excellent accommodation for families, the Master bedroom has an En-suite shower room with his and hers basins. The family bathroom is stylish and spacious, featuring both a freestanding bath and a separate shower, combining comfort and practicality.

Externally, the property is set on a substantial corner plot. To the front is a large driveway providing ample off-road parking, along with a paved garden area. To the rear is an initial decking area, ideal for outdoor seating, with steps leading down to a large allotment space and a further expansive lawn. The entire garden enjoys the same far-reaching views, offering plenty of space for outdoor relaxation, entertaining and enjoying the surroundings.

Council Tax Band E

All services and mains water are connected to the property.

The broadband internet is provided to the property by Cable, the sellers are subscribed to Sky. Please visit the Ofcom website to check broadband availability and speeds.

The owner has advised that the level of the mobile signal/coverage at the property is good, they are subscribed to EE. Please visit the Ofcom website to check mobile coverage.
